Summary

There’s something grounding about the idea of home—where you feel safe, settled, and secure. But what happens when that sense of safety is suddenly shaken?In this episode of The Policy Project by Policybazaar.ae, we confront that very question.Recent events like the Tiger Tower fire have brought home insurance to the forefront of public conversation. And yet, many in the UAE—especially renters—still overlook it, believing it’s unnecessary or too complex.Featuring Toshita Chauhan, Chief Business Officer at Policybazaar.ae, we go beyond the fine print to explore why home insurance is no longer optional. From breaking down cover types to decoding claims processes and tenant liability, we simplify it all. You’ll also hear real audience questions answered—on water leaks, jewelry, alternative stays, and more.Because protection doesn’t start after the damage—it starts with a plan.
